Pettenati Industria Textil  (BSP:PTNT4) Quick Ratio Explanation

The quick ratio is more conservative than the Current Ratio because it excludes inventories from current assets. The ratio derives its name presumably from the fact that assets such as cash and marketable securities are quick sources of cash. Inventories generally take time to be converted into cash, and if they have to be sold quickly, the company may have to accept a lower price than book value of these inventories. As a result, they are justifiably excluded from assets that are ready sources of immediate cash.

In general, low or decreasing quick ratios generally suggest that a company is over-leveraged, struggling to maintain or grow sales, paying bills too quickly or collecting receivables too slowly. On the other hand, a high or increasing quick ratio generally indicates that a company is experiencing solid top-line growth, quickly converting receivables into cash, and easily able to cover its financial obligations. Such companies often have faster inventory turnover and cash conversion cycles.

The higher the quick ratio, the better the company's liquidity position.

Pettenati Industria Textil Quick Ratio Calculation

The quick ratio measures a company's ability to meet its short-term obligations with its most liquid assets. For this reason, the ratio excludes inventories from current assets.

Pettenati Industria Textil's Quick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Jun. 2025 is calculated as

Quick Ratio (A: Jun. 2025 )=(Total Current Assets-Total Inventories)/Total Current Liabilities
=(569.774-164.28)/229.712
=1.77

Pettenati Industria Textil's Quick 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Quick Ratio (Q: Dec. 2025 )=(Total Current Assets-Total Inventories)/Total Current Liabilities
=(638.731-162.593)/154.533
=3.08

Pettenati Industria Textil Business Description

Address Rodovia RSC, 453 Km 2.4, Caxias Do Sul, RS, BRA, 95010550
Pettenati SA Industria Textil manufactures fabrics finished in mesh point and apparel. The company creates, develops, tests, manufactures and markets types of fabrics covering dyed woven and printed fabric types. The company's product line include Softs, Plushs, Half Meshes, Viscose and Sport Lines, among others.
